Mahathir mohamad Legacy: A Nation Divided, a Region at Risk

Mahathir Mohamad Legacy: A Nation Divided, a Region at Risk,a comprehensive analysis of contemporary Malaysia and the struggle for its political and economic leadership takes a close look at former Malaysian Prime Minister Mahathir Mohamad. Highlighted are Mahathir's two decades in power and the path of economic progress and political stability on which he has guided Malaysia. But, in 1998, a falling-out with his deputy, Anwar Ibrahim, escalated into the Anwar affair, which damaged the credibility of the administration and spurred fundamentalist opposition to Mahathir and the direction the country was heading. This book details the concerns for Malaysia's future; with Mahathir Mohamad set to retire in the fall of 2003 and concerns that the country is becoming a hotbed of terrorists and zealots, Malaysia is at political and economic crossroads and the balance of power in Southeast Asia is at risk.

The Mahathir Mohamad Legacy: A Nation Divided, a Region at Risk


Mahathir Mohamad Legacy: A Nation Divided, a Region at Risk is writen by Ian Stewart, a journalist who has written for The New York Times, The Australian, The South China Morning Post, The New Zealand Herald, The Sydney Herald, and The Melbourne Herald. He is the author of The Peking Payoff, The Seizing of Peking, Deadline in Jakarta, and Reunion.

Malaysian Maverick: Mahathir Mohamad in Turbulent Times

"Malaysia Maverick : Mahathir Mohamad in Turbulent Times" is a good book about Mahathir Bin Mohamad, former Malaysia prime minister. The main focus is on his time as a prime minister, but also includes chapters on his life before joining politics, his rise to power and his time after stepping down. The book is not organized in a strictly chronological way, but with one chapter for each major topic, such as Mahathir's 'vision of a modern nation', his economic policies, scandals, monarchy, foreign policy, his rivals etc. Very interesting was the chapter about the struggle over Mahathir's legacy and how things did not work out as he had expected after he stepped down. Some of the chapters are more about the particular topics than about Mahathir and often it is not even apparent what Mahathir's role was.

The Malay Dilemma by Mahathir Mohamad

The Malay Dilemma by former prime minister of Malaysia, Mahathir Mohamad examines and analyses the make-up of the Malays and the problem of racial harmony in Malaysia. First published in 1970, the book seeks to explain the causes for the 13 May 1969 riots in Kuala Lumpur. The book was once bannned, then it was lifted sometime after Mahathir became the Prime Minister of Malaysia.

The Malay Dilemma


Dr Mahathir sets out his view as to why the Malays are economically backward and why they feel they must insist upon immigrants becoming real Malaysians speaking in due course nothing but Malay, as do immigrants to America or Australia speak nothing but the language of what the author calls "the definitive people". He argues that the Malays are the rightful owners of Malaya. He also argues that immigrants are guests until properly absorbed, and that they are not properly absorbed until they have abandoned the language and culture of their past.
